Hannah Abrams, Senior Policy and Advocacy Officer at the Food Foundation, argues the case for the HAF (Holiday Activities and Food) Programme that keeps kids on Free School Meals properly nourished during the school holidays. She argues that with the Government's pledge to expand school meals to an additional half a million children from the September 2026 school term, the expansion of HAF is a missing link.
